Intended Use
The Bard Coagulating Resector is indicated for resection and coagulation of soft tissue and is intended for use with compatible resectoscopes.
Device Story
Monopolar electrosurgical electrode; delivers radio frequency energy from cleared electrosurgical generator to soft tissue. Used for resection and coagulation. Operated by surgeons in clinical settings (e.g., OR) via compatible resectoscopes (CIRCON ACMI, Wolf, Storz, Olympus). Device consists of metal loop tip, conductive wire, polymer insulator tubing, and stainless steel outer shaft. Facilitates tissue removal and hemostasis during urological or similar endoscopic procedures.
Clinical Evidence
Bench testing only; no clinical data provided.
Technological Characteristics
Monopolar electrosurgical electrode; metal loop tip; conductive wire with polymer insulator tubing; distal stainless steel outer shaft; compatible with standard electrosurgical generators; manual operation via resectoscope.
Indications for Use
Indicated for resection and coagulation of soft tissue in patients requiring electrosurgical procedures using compatible resectoscopes.
Regulatory Classification
Identification
An endoscopic electrosurgical unit and accessories is a device used to perform electrosurgical procedures through an endoscope. This generic type of device includes the electrosurgical generator, patient plate, electric biopsy forceps, electrode, flexible snare, electrosurgical alarm system, electrosurgical power supply unit, electrical clamp, self-opening rigid snare, flexible suction coagulator electrode, patient return wristlet, contact jelly, adaptor to the cord for transurethral surgical instruments, the electric cord for transurethral surgical instruments, and the transurethral desiccator.

# Table VI.1
## Comparison Summary of Technological Characteristics
| Comparison Topic | Bard Coagulating Resector | Microvasive Wedge™ Electrosurgical Resection Device (Predicate Device) | CIRCON ACMI Right Angle Cutting Loop Electrode (Predicate Device) |
| --- | --- | --- | --- |
| **Indications or Intended Use** | (Indications) The Bard Coagulating Resector is indicated for resection and coagulation of soft tissue and is intended for use with compatible resectoscopes. | (Intended Use) Intended for cutting and coagulation during resection. To be used with compatible resectoscopes. | (Intended Use) Intended for cutting (resection). To be used with compatible resectoscopes. |
| **Resectoscope Compatibility** | Examples of resectoscope compatibility include CIRCON ACMI (both USA and Classic series), Wolf, Storz (both Single and Double stem), and Olympus resectoscope. | Models available for CIRCON ACMI USA series and Storz (Single stem) resectoscopes. | Fits compatible CIRCON ACMI resectoscopes. |
| **Electrode Tip** | Metal loop. | Metal loop. | Wire loop. |
| **Body Construction** | Conductive wire jacketed with black (polymer) insulator tubing and further jacketed with distal stainless steel outer shaft. | Conductive wire jacketed with polymer insulator tubing. | Conductive wire jacketed with polymer insulator tubing. |
| **Proximal Construction** | Conductive contact compatible with specific resectoscopes. | Conductive contact compatible with specific resectoscopes. | Conductive contact compatible with specific resectoscopes. |
| **Stabilizer** | On applicable models. | On all models. | On all models. |
